Advertisement

针对RuoYi v3.8.7-RuoYi-Vue-fast的达梦DM8兼容性改进版

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本版本为RuoYi v3.8.7的优化版,专为达梦数据库DM8设计,增强了系统的兼容性和性能,提供更加流畅稳定的开发体验。 基于RuoYi v3.8.7 和 RuoYi-Vue-fast 版本,对系统进行了适配达梦DM8数据库的修改工作。此次更新主要集中在确保系统的稳定性和兼容性上,以适应新的数据库环境需求,并优化了部分功能模块,提升了用户体验和性能表现。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• RuoYi v3.8.7-RuoYi-Vue-fastDM8
    优质
    本版本为RuoYi v3.8.7的优化版,专为达梦数据库DM8设计,增强了系统的兼容性和性能,提供更加流畅稳定的开发体验。 基于RuoYi v3.8.7 和 RuoYi-Vue-fast 版本,对系统进行了适配达梦DM8数据库的修改工作。此次更新主要集中在确保系统的稳定性和兼容性上,以适应新的数据库环境需求,并优化了部分功能模块,提升了用户体验和性能表现。
  • RuoYi-Vue-vue3+
    优质
    RuoYi-Vue-vue3+是一款基于Vue 3框架和RuoYi生态体系打造的企业级后端开发解决方案,为开发者提供了快速构建复杂应用的能力。 Spring Boot, Spring Security, JWT, Vue 3 & Element Vue 3
  • RuoYi-Vue-Plus:分布式集群与多租户场景全面升级(不原框架)
    优质
    RuoYi-Vue-Plus是RuoYi系列的重大更新版本,专为分布式集群及多租户环境设计,提供显著增强的安全性、可扩展性和性能优化。此版本完全重构,并不与原始框架兼容。 《RuoYi-Vue-Plus:分布式集群与多租户场景下的全面升级》 RuoYi-Vue-Plus 是一个基于 Vue.js 框架的后台管理系统,它是 RuoYi-Vue 的全新版本,专为大规模、高并发和复杂组织结构设计。这一版在原有基础上进行了深度改造,以满足分布式集群与多租户场景的需求,并且不兼容之前的框架。 一、Vue.js 技术栈的应用 RuoYi-Vue-Plus 使用 Vue.js 构建用户界面,通过虚拟DOM技术优化页面渲染速度和用户体验。同时,利用 Vue Router 和 Vuex 分别实现路由管理和状态管理功能,提升开发效率与系统性能。 二、分布式集群支持 在分布式环境下,该框架引入了服务发现机制(如 Consul 或 Eureka)及负载均衡策略(例如 Nginx 或 Ribbon),确保系统的高可用性和容错性。即使单点故障发生时,整个应用仍能正常运行并处理大量并发请求。 三、多租户架构设计 RuoYi-Vue-Plus 支持多租户模式,通过数据库表前缀和动态配置等方式实现不同客户的数据隔离与安全保护。这使得系统管理员能够便捷地创建、管理和删除各个独立的租户实例以适应不同的业务需求。 四、安全性强化 针对分布式环境下的复杂应用场景,RuoYi-Vue-Plus 引入了 OAuth2 认证协议和 JWT 会话管理机制来增强系统的安全防护能力。此外,还可能包含权限控制及 API 安全策略等措施以防止未经授权的访问。 五、微服务架构 为了适应分布式环境下的开发需求,RuoYi-Vue-Plus 可能采用了微服务设计模式,并通过 RESTful API 实现各模块间的通信与协作。这种灵活的设计提高了系统的可维护性及扩展能力。 六、监控和日志管理 在大型分布式系统中,有效的性能监测和故障排查至关重要。因此 RuoYi-Vue-Plus 可能集成了 Prometheus 和 Grafana 等工具进行实时监控,并使用 ELK 堆栈来收集分析应用的日志信息从而及时发现并解决问题。 七、持续集成与部署 为了提高开发效率及保证软件质量,RuoYi-Vue-Plus 有可能采用 Jenkins 或 GitLab CI/CD 工具实现自动化构建测试流程以确保每次更新都能高效可靠地发布到生产环境当中去。 综上所述,RuoYi-Vue-Plus 是一个专为复杂业务场景设计的后台管理系统。它利用 Vue.js 的强大功能实现了高可用性、高性能以及安全性目标,并为企业级应用提供了强有力的技术支撑。通过对该框架架构和关键技术的理解,开发人员可以更好地构建满足现代商业需求的应用系统。
  • ruoyi-vue-pro-master.zip
    优质
    ruoyi-vue-pro-master.zip是基于Spring Boot和Vue.js开发的一款企业级前后端分离开源项目框架,适用于快速开发后台管理系统。 RuoYi-Vue 全新 Pro 版本对所有功能进行了优化重构。该系统基于 Spring Boot + MyBatis Plus + Vue & Element 构建,是一个集成了后台管理系统与微信小程序的平台,支持 RBAC 动态权限、数据权限、SaaS 多租户、Flowable 工作流以及三方登录、支付、短信和商城等功能。
  • Nacos 2.1.2 8数据库调整
    优质
    本文章详细介绍Nacos 2.1.2版本对国产达梦8数据库的支持和适配优化,帮助用户解决跨库使用中的问题与挑战。 Nacos 2.1.2 版本修复了上一个版本中存在的注册服务及配置无分页功能的问题,并增加了对国产数据库达梦8的适配支持。需要在 conf/application.properties 文件中更新数据库配置,具体如下: db.jdbcDriverName=dm.jdbc.driver.DmDriver db.url.0=jdbc:dm://127.0.0.1:5236
  • 若依(Ruoyi) Ruoyi-Vue Ruoyi-Cloud 微服务全套视频教程网盘资源
    优质
    本套教程全面覆盖若依(Ruoyi)框架及其Vue前端和微服务体系(Ruoyi-Cloud),提供详尽的视频教学与丰富的网盘资源,助力开发者快速掌握高效开发技能。 若依(Ruoyi)、ruoyi-vue 和 ruoyi-cloud 是一些流行的开源项目框架。以下是关于 RuoYi-Cloud 微服务版本的视频课程目录: ├──01 项目概述.mp4 20.77M ├──02 微架构概念.mp4 20.99M ├──03 微架构及选型.mp4 21.19M ├──04 目录文件介绍.mp4 17.16M ├──05 项目运行.mp4 108.31M ├──06 构建发布到Linux.mp4 70.13M ├──07 开发环境运行.mp4 82.35M ├──08 服务网关介绍.mp4 23.32M ├──09 使用服务网关.mp4 35.82M ├──10 网关路由规则.mp4 27.60M ├──11 网关路由配置.mp4 15.71M ├──12 网关限流配置.mp4 34.21M ├──13 网关熔断降级.mp4 30.85M ├──14 网关跨域配置.mp4 35.81M ├──15 网关黑名单配置.mp4 10.88M
  • RuoYi-Vue-Oracle (RuoYi):基于SpringBoot官方库,包含Spring Security、JWT和Vue...
    优质
    RuoYi-Vue-Oracle是基于Spring Boot开发的一款企业级应用框架,集成了Spring Security、JWT认证及前端Vue.js技术,适用于快速构建安全可靠的Web应用程序。 本仓库为RuoYi-Vue的Oracle版本,并保持同步更新。前端采用Vue与Element UI框架,后端初步采用了Spring Boot、Spring Security以及Redis及Jwt技术栈。系统使用Jwt进行权限认证支持多终端登录。 该版本还支持动态加载用户权限菜单并提供多种方式实现灵活便捷的权限控制机制。此外,代码生成器可以一键快速生成前端所需的基础代码,极大提高开发效率。 平台内置了多项实用功能: - 用户管理:配置和维护系统操作者的信息。 - 部门管理:设置系统的组织结构(包括公司、部门及小组等),并支持以树形展示的方式实现数据权限的控制。 - 职位管理:定义用户在系统中的职位信息。 - 菜单管理:设定系统菜单及相关操作和按钮权限标识,确保安全性和功能性。 - 角色管理:分配角色对应的菜单权限,并依据机构来划分相应的数据范围权限。 - 字典管理:提供对常用固定值的管理和维护功能。
  • RuoYi-Vue-Multi-Tenant:在RuoYi-Vue基础上拓展多租户框架(Spring Boot, Spring Security...)
    优质
    RuoYi-Vue-Multi-Tenant是在RuoYi-Vue项目基础上开发的,集成了Spring Boot和Spring Security等技术的多租户解决方案,适用于构建复杂的多租户应用系统。 若一维多租户GitHub项目介绍基于RuoYi-Vue扩展的多租户框架(SpringBoot,Spring Security,JWT,Vue&Element的前后端分离权限管理系统)。环境准备如下: 1. 将项目克隆到本地。 2. 在项目的脚本段落件中找到`/ruo-yi-vue-multi-tenant/ruoyi/multi_tenant.sql`并将其导入MySQL数据库。 3. 修改配置(未列出的具体配置请根据实际情况自行调整): ``` # 数据源 spring.datasource.druid.master.url = jdbc:mysql://127.0.0.1:3306/mt?useUnicode=true&characterEncoding=utf8&zeroDateTimeBehavior=convertToNull ```
  • RuoYi-Activiti
    优质
    RuoYi-Activiti是基于Spring Boot与Activiti工作流引擎集成开发的企业级应用框架,适用于快速构建企业流程管理平台。 《深入理解RuoYi-Activiti:企业工作流引擎的实践指南》 RuoYi-Activiti是一款基于Spring的工作流管理平台,它结合了开源框架Activiti的强大功能,并针对国内企业的业务场景进行了优化设计,提供了更加友好的用户体验。本段落将详细介绍该系统的原理、核心组件及其在实际应用中的使用方法。 一、简介 RuoYi-Activiti是通过集成RuoYi框架和Activiti技术而形成的强大工作流解决方案,旨在为用户提供高效且灵活的工作流程管理服务。除了支持标准的流程设计与追踪功能外,还包含自定义表单创建、权限控制以及实时监控等高级特性。 二、Activiti基础 1. 核心概念:Activiti基于BPMN 2.0规范构建,涵盖多种关键元素如任务、网关和事件。 2. 流程定义(Process Definition): 使用BPMN 2.0图形工具创建流程定义文件,包含各个业务操作的逻辑。 3. 流程实例(Process Instance):当启动一个已定义好的流程时,会生成对应的执行实例。 4. 任务(Task):在每个运行中的流程中代表具体的待办事项或职责分配。 三、RuoYi-Activiti增强特性 1. 自定义表单:允许用户根据需求设计个性化的工作界面。 2. 权限控制:基于角色的访问控制系统确保了对敏感信息和操作的安全管理。 3. 流程监控:提供实时查看流程状态与性能分析的功能。 四、实战指南 步骤包括部署新的工作流定义,启动实例,并处理分配的任务。此外还可以通过RuoYi-Activiti内置工具进行详细的运行状况检查和优化建议。 五、Spring集成 将Activiti嵌入到Spring框架中可以进一步提高其灵活性与可维护性,利用依赖注入机制简化配置过程并增强安全性保障措施。 综上所述,对于寻求改善内部业务流程的企业而言,RuoYi-Activiti提供了一个极具吸引力的选择。它不仅继承了原生Activiti的优点,还通过额外的功能扩展和用户界面改进提升了整体体验水平。